“The Future’s Technology Meets the Turkish Miner” – Mining-Tech 2024 in Ankara

Organized by Madencilik Türkiye, the first and only magazine in its field in our country, which has been in publication for 15 years, “Mining-Tech – Mining Industry Technology Days” is set to hold its second event due to high demand. Following the success of the inaugural event in September 2022, the second edition will be held on December 12-13, 2024, at Hacettepe University Beytepe Campus Culture and Congress Center in Ankara, featuring a similar format but in a larger area.

At Mining-Tech 2024, advanced technologies used in mineral exploration and production will be showcased in exhibition areas and explained in concurrent sessions, highlighting the technological face of the Turkish Mining Industry. The event aims to bring together technology-producing companies with mining companies using these technologies, ensuring the highest contribution to the mining sector with the participation of leading and powerful firms in the industry.

Mining-Tech will cover a wide range of topics, including but not limited to:

  • MINERAL EXPLORATION AND PRODUCTION TECHNOLOGIES: All technological devices and software that facilitate mineral exploration and production.
  • SMART MINING: Utilizing technology for high productivity, enhanced safety, and low operating costs.
  • MINING SOFTWARE: Modeling, mapping, planning, design, management, and more.
  • MEASUREMENT-ANALYSIS TECHNOLOGIES: Recording and processing data.
  • PROCESS TECHNOLOGIES: Technological monitoring of processes and increased production.
  • OCCUPATIONAL SAFETY TECHNOLOGIES: Ensuring safe mining through technology use.
